Jay Leno’s prepared to make-up for his “gay face” ways. The sometimes-funny man will appear tomorrow at a West Hollywood rally for gay marriage. From Marc Malkin:
The Tonight Show host decided to make an appearance in support of the recent legalization of gay marriage by California’s Supreme Court.
“He said that he is from Massachusetts and that the sky did not fall in their state when marriage equality became the law of the land there,” a rep for the event said. “He wants to impress upon everyone here in California that the sky will not fall here either.”
TR Knight and Judy Shepard will also appear at the event, which encourages voters to come out against the proposed amendment rebanning gay marriage in California. While it’s a great message, aren’t they preaching to the WeHo choir?
